The Arts - Music

In November Year 1and 2 pupils had the opportunity to become African drummers. They even had to perform their drumming patterns on the Stage in the hall! This work was part of a partnership with Woldgate College (Performing Arts Status). It also links well with our Creative Contexts Project.

In November Mr Richard Simpkins, the community musician for Woldgate College, came to Bishop Wilton to teach some music lessons on Rhythm patterns. We filmed some of the work in school.

 

Mr Simpkins – Community Musician at Woldgate College - came to school to lead a very enjoyable music workshop with the infant children. They learned about rhythm patterns and enjoyed experimenting with sound on a range of authentic ethnic instruments

 

Wider Opportunities
Ms Lumb comes to school every Tuesday to teach all the junior pupils how to play the recorder. They have learnt a lot in a short period of time and are now able to improvise compositions around the notes b,c,d,a, and g. We are proud to say that 45% of our school pupils are now learning an instrument during school hours!
